Duelist Kingdom[] Furious over their betrayal, the Big Five strike a deal with Maximillion Pegasus, similar to their previous deal with Seto: if Pegasus defeats Seto and Yugi Muto in Duels, then they will vote Pegasus into power of the company by kidnapping Seto's brother Mokuba, who has been entrusted with the card that contains the information the Big Five need to take over the company (In the dub, they wanted Pegasus to Duel and defeat Yugi because after he defeated Kaiba, Kaiba Corp's reputation was tarnished and they need a Kaiba family member to make any control legal) Though shadowed during this time, the Big Five are first unshadowed when they watch Maximillion Pegasus' Duel against Yugi Muto on their monitor (In the Dub, they planned to broadcasted Pegasus' victory over Yugi nationwide, which will help Kaiba Corp regain its reputation)
